WebA military/federal nurse may not hold a multi-state license from more than one Compact state at a time. Nurses licensed in a compact state, i.e. Texas and whose primary state of residence is another compact state i.e. Maryland, may not hold an active license in Texas. The nurse will need a Maryland license. WebHow to Apply for a Compact State Nursing License. This provides nurses career … city cat litterWebCurrently, Delaware does not have multistate Advanced Practice Registered Nurse (APRN) licenses. To practice as an APRN in Delaware, an APRN must hold a Delaware-issued APRN license regardless of whether he/she holds an APRN license in another state.
